What Is PPC advertising? 

Pay per click adverting provides an easy way for your customers to link to your website or app. 

They appear above normal or organic search results when someone searches for a related phrase or keyword. And unlike an organic result, advertisers only pay when someone clicks on their advert. 

PPC Campaigns And Keywords 

When you sign-up to a PPC platform, you create a campaign. 

Campaigns help you segment your ads into groups for easier management. You could have a campaign for a product range or seasonal services, for example. 

Campaigns can contain multiple ads and each ad must target one or more keywords. 

Keywords are the search phrases your visitors enter to find your product or service. They could be product-specific, like make and model. Or more general, like a brand. 

The great news is each advert platform provides free tools to help you find the best keywords. 

Google's Keyword Planner tool tells you how many people searched for your proposed keywords. It also gives suggestions, so you can target better phrases for more traffic. 

Pay Per Click Advertising Platforms 

There are three main PPC marketing platforms that host your ads: Google, Microsoft, and Amazon. 

Google is the most-used search engine in the world, having over 90% market share. Its Google Ads advertising platform lets you place your adverts throughout its extensive network. That includes Search, Maps, Android apps, and third-party vendors. 

Unsurprisingly, Google makes most of its money from advertising. But the reason is simple: it is very effective. 

Google claims that for every dollar you spend on their ad network you will receive $8 in profit! 

However, Google's success also means it's the most expensive platform. That is why Microsoft reduced its prices. 

Microsoft Advertising offers a similar service to Google but your ads appear in Bing results. As Bing powers the likes of Yahoo!, that is quite a catchment area for a lower cost. 

And don't forget about Amazon. 

The retail giant is the fastest-growing ad platform for eCommerce websites. If you sell on their store then this is the place to spend your marketing budget. 

Types Of PPC Ads 

The main type of advert is the text ad

In Google, these appear above organic listings and look almost identical to those results. There is a small AD symbol to signify they are ads but otherwise, they don't stand out. 

Display ads reflect the more traditional image or banner advertisement. 

They are great if you want to promote using pictures of your products. Animated Gifs allow for multimedia too so you can grab people's attention. But they only appear on third-party sites or in Android apps. 

Shopping ads provide the best of both worlds. 

They appear above organic listings as an image and text. Mobile users can swipe across the screen to view more results. And they integrate with the likes of Google Shopping. 

How Much Will It Cost? 

PPC sounds good so far but let's talk money. How much does pay per click advertising cost? 

PPC is unlike traditional online ads where you pay for the time your ad appears. Instead, you are given an estimate on the cost per click or CPC based on your chosen keywords. 

Prices vary per keyword or phrase and also on the competition. 

The more businesses compete for a key phrase, the higher the price. It's termed bidding and costs vary. 

For example, the keyword 'business services' could set you back a whopping $58.64 per click! And if you own a casino and want to advertise on Google that word alone fetches $55.48. 

That's why PPC strategies are so important when advertising online.

SEO Versus PPC 

Search engine optimization means ensuring Google likes your website and ranks you high on their organic results. But by using PPC, does that mean you should stop or ignore SEO? 

The short answer is no! 

PPC can bring targeted traffic in the short term but SEO can generate similar results over time. Some users ignore ads and go straight for the free listings. And if you are on the first page you will see a huge spike in traffic. 

SEO techniques like creating high-quality content will also reap rewards outside of search. 

Visitors will bookmark your pages if you provide great copy like blog articles. They will also share your site on social media. And that will generate a new stream of traffic outside the confines of Google.

Top 7 Modern Business Card Designs


1. Minimalism

Minimalism is a longstanding design trend that is going to make a re-appearance. This design makes things simple and easy to read and communicates the basic information only. 

Designing a minimalistic card is an art in itself. It’s crucial to only put the necessary information on the business card and leave plenty of white space.

Take a look at top modern product options to design a minimalist business card today. 


2. Interactive Design

This design included business cards that make customers interact with the card in one way or another. 

It’s a great way to get your customers talking about you or the business. 

It works as ‘free’ advertising, as people are more likely to pass on or show other unusual designs. 

You could also make part of the card useful, like incorporating a USB drive or a multitool.


3. Nautical Stripes

Nautical stripes are always trendy, providing they match with your business branding. They are a simple and professional way to include color in your business card design. 


4. Smart Cards

As we mentioned, the digital age of smartphones and developing technology may mean that some people won’t be interested in the old fashioned business card. If your target market is mostly Millenials, then it may be worth investing in smart cards. 

You can use the smart card to feature a basic design, but include a QR code for further information or coupons. 


5. Big Fonts

Big fonts are another trend to watch out for this year. Big, bold fonts really catch the eye of potential customers. They are also very memorable. 


6. Clever Symbols

Including clever symbols in the design is another way to make your business stand out amongst your competitors. Think about your logo and branding, and see if there is any way you can include a clever symbol or play on words into your business card.


7. Perforated Cards

Perforated cards are great for promotional deals or ‘refer a friend’ deals. Simply tear off the perforated edge and hand it to another person. Technically, this type of business card gives you a 2 in 1 card.

Keep Location in Mind When Looking for a Pro Venue

This should almost go without saying. But you should not, under any circumstances, rent a venue for a professional event if it's situated in a place that's going to be difficult for your guests to get to.

If, for example, you're going to be hosting an event in San Francisco, look for an event space that's somewhere within the city limits. If you roam too far outside of San Francisco, you're going to find that many of your guests might skip your event since it won't be convenient for them to get there.

You want to make it as easy as possible for all your guests to make their way to your event. With that in mind, choosing a pro venue that's located in the right place is an absolute must when you're planning out your event.


Make Sure a Venue Offers More Than Enough Parking

Once people show up for your event, are they going to be able to find a place to park?

This might not be a question that you ever consider when you're planning out an event. You'll be so worried about what's inside of a venue that you won't spend a ton of time thinking about what's outside of it.

Find out how many parking spaces are going to be available to your guests on the night of your event. 

The last thing you want is for people to show up at your event and leave when they realize that the parking situation is a nightmare.


Search for a Venue With Enough Space for Everyone on Your Guest List

One of the first things you should ask the owner of an event space when you're meeting with them about their venue is, "What is your capacity?" The capacity will let you know how many people you can fit into a venue at one time.

You should obviously do this for the comfort of your guests. You don't want to try cramming 400 people into a space that's only designed to hold 200 people. It'll lead to people spending the entire night bumping into one another.

It'll also go against all of the fire and safety codes that are in place and could get your event shut down if you're not careful. You want to make sure that the pro venue you pick has a capacity that sits well above the total number of names on your guest list.


See Which Services and Amenities a Venue Offers

There are some venues that will rent you an event space and leave it at that. They won't offer any extra services or amenities, which will leave you to bring in your own vendors to provide them.

But there are also venues that will extend all the services and amenities that you need for your event, either included in the cost of renting the venue or for an additional fee.

Some of the services and amenities that you'll likely need will include:

  • Catering
  • Table, chair, and linen rentals
  • Audio-visual equipment

You might also need someone to help you set up a venue for your event and clean it up once it's over. You should come to an understanding with the owner of an event space as far as which services and amenities they will provide.


Consider the Layout of a Venue When Thinking About Using It

The type of event that you're planning will dictate the type of layout that you'll need inside of a pro venue.

For instance, if you're planning an awards show, you'll need a large stage for performers and presenters. You'll also need plenty of room to put chairs for your audience. This means that a venue with a bunch of smaller rooms isn't going to work for you.

By the same token, if you're holding a seminar that's going to feature different speakers talking to different groups, you might benefit from a venue with a choppy layout. It'll give you an opportunity to send those who attend your event to different areas based on what and who they want to see.

When you walk into a venue for the first time and it's empty, you're going to need to be able to picture your event taking place in it to see if it'll work. It's why it's essential for you to spend time thinking about how you envision your event going before settling on an event space.


Ask a Venue About Their Acoustics

Is there anything worse than spending tons of time and money staging a big event only to have guests complaining about how noisy it is inside? This is something that event planners don't always take into account when planning professional events.

You should speak with an event space owner about the acoustics in their facility and push them to tell you how speakers and music will sound during your event. Poor acoustics can ruin an event and make it impossible for people to enjoy themselves.

You should be especially wary about holding an event in a big, open space like a warehouse. These types of spaces don't always have the best acoustics, and the acoustics can ruin an otherwise great event in some cases.


Check Out the Accessibility of a Venue

A lot of event planners enjoy holding events in older venues that have a ton of history jam-packed into them. These venues often entice guests and get people talking about how lovely they are.

There is one big problem with many older venues, though. They don't always offer the same kinds of accessibility that you will find in most newer venues. They sometimes haven't gone through the necessary upgrades to make them more accessible.

You want to find a venue that makes it simple for people with mobility issues to get around. A pro venue should have everything from ramps to elevators inside of it to allow for people to maneuver their way around without a problem.


Figure Out If a Venue Fits Into Your Budget

The cost to rent a pro venue is going to depend on dozens of different things. Some of the factors that will impact the price of a venue include:

  • The location of the venue
  • The size of the venue
  • The services and amenities that a venue offers
  • The history of a venue
  • The general appearance of a venue

Prior to looking around at different venues for a professional event, you should find out exactly when you want to rent a venue. This will help you avoid falling in love with a venue only to discover that it is booked on the night you need it.

You should also crunch the numbers and figure out how much you can afford to spend on a venue based on your event budget. It will allow you to steer clear of finding the perfect venue only to find out that it is out of your price range.

Cost shouldn't be the only thing on your mind when you are shopping around for venues for an event. You don't want to take the cheapest venue you can find and learn first-hand why it was so cheap in the first place.

But you should be open and honest about your event budget from the beginning with venue owners.

They might be able to find ways to work with your budget if it means renting out their venue for your event.


Book the Best Pro Venue for Your Next Professional Event

The pro venue that you choose for your next professional event could ultimately make or break it. 

Choosing the wrong venue could leave people with a bad taste in their mouth once your event ends.

Try to start looking around at various venues at least six months before your event is scheduled to take place. This will give you an opportunity to check out and consider a wide range of options before narrowing your choices down.

Once you find a venue that suits your needs, put down a deposit for it and start planning out the other details of your event. Your venue will establish a strong foundation for your event and get the planning process off to a great start.

Decide What Your Goals Are 

Before you can set a concrete digital marketing budget, you first need to decide what your goals are. 

This is because your goals will determine the level of competition you will face. And the level of competition you face will determine how much you need to spend. 

Suppose you want to acquire more customers with the help of Google AdWords

You can use the Google Keyword Planner to discover how much existing advertisers are paying to target certain keywords. You can then take these figures, and use them to estimate the amount of money you'd need to spend on your frugal online marketing campaigns. 

This is just one example of how you can use the competition to determine how much you need to spend on your frugal online marketing campaigns. 

You can adopt a similar approach for any digital marketing method. All you need to do is look at what the competition is spending, and you then have a rough idea of how much you need to frugally budget for digital marketing. 

How Flexible Is Your Approach? 

It is worth remembering that some marketing tactics will cost more than others. For instance, you'll generally find that LinkedIn Ads are more expensive than Facebook Ads. 

So, if you are struggling to create an affordable marketing plan, maybe introduce some flexibility to your approach. You may really want to run PPC ads, but if you can't make the numbers work, then it's best to go for an affordable alternative option. 

Now, if you are looking for affordable marketing ideas, you will have to be creative. You might need to run an influencer marketing campaign, or you may need to host some events that help generate brand awareness. 

Such approaches might not provide the kind of ROI you would experience when using traditional marketing methods. But they are often a good way to help you generate your first set of customers so that you can eventually move onto more expensive methods.

4 Techniques For Customers' Customized Needs

1. Direct Printing

Direct printing or DTG ( Direct to garment) printing is when designs are emblazoned directly upon the garments employing water-based inks with the help of ink-jet printers. 

The fabric or garment are heated during the pre-printing phase and then coated with the ink to facilitate better absorption of the ink. 

Direct to fabric printing requires a minimalistic setup that can be sampled quickly and more cheaply than screen printing. As you can see, it is just a one-step process. Thus the turnaround time is also relatively less. 

Direct to garment printing leaves very little waste since the printer directly works on the canopy fabric – therefore, less energy is consumed. So if you are looking for a value for money, pocket-friendly, quick one-off print, you should opt for direct printing. 

2. Screen Printing

Screen printed marquee tents are extremely popular amongst the marquee enthusiasts as bigger areas can be printed upon at the same time, economically. This technique is used to bulk produce printed marquee walls, logos, texts, slogans, and graphic artworks. 

It involves designing screens for every colour from the artwork, a single screen can be used for printing repeatedly. Thus it is used for producing printed marquee tents in bulk. 

Marquee screen printing ensures superior quality of finishing because the ink lies within the fabric layer and thus easily visible on darker fabrics as well. 

Screen printed marquees have quite a thick print (up to 20 microns) ensuring a rich finish. This technique can be employed to print on canvasses as large as 3x4 meters at one go. Not only canvasses but anything like plastic, metal, acrylic, and wood that can fit the printers can be embossed upon by screen printing. 

Marquee screen printing is beneficial in the long run owing to their good light resilience. Greater ink thickness and composition ensure that the print can withstand greater stress without compromising on print quality. 

3. Sublimation Printing

Sublimation is a chemical process where solid changes into a gas without passing through the liquid stage and that is exactly how ink is embossed upon the fabric using this technique. 

Since there is no liquid involved, there is no need to dry off the print. 

Sublimation printer first imprints a mirror image of the content or design that is to be printed and then it is transferred upon a fabric. Both, the paper and fabric undergo a heat press which sublimates the solid print into a gaseous state that permeates the pores of the fabric that open due to heat. The fabric is then cooled for the pores to close so that the ink can be a solid once again. This when the fabric and ink become one. 

Dye sublimation produces a continuous print tone. This projects brighter and smoother colours on the fabric of your printed canopy, which is far better than what an ink-jet printer can manage. 

Also since the dye is deeply embedded in the fabrics of the printed marquee, the designs or artwork embossed remain permanent. This ensures that your branded gazebo can withstand the toughest of times and weathers. 

Sublimation printing can be employed to print a variety of designs, artworks, colours, shades etc. that other forms of printing do not allow. 

4. UV Printing

UV printing is a photochemical process that uses ultraviolet light to digitally print logos, graphics, artwork, and content over almost any surface which can fit in the printer. 

UV printers use mercury, quartz, or LED lights for curing instead of heat. High-intensity UV lights distribute the special ink evenly on the printing medium. 

UV printing can be done on 3-D objects, curved surfaces etc. Once the printing is over with, the surface or medium do not require the application of any protective film or coating, making them readily available for finishing. 

This is the flagship of the printing industry and produces the most premium prints that money can buy. The UV prints are smear-resistant and can last up to 3-5 years outdoors and almost 10 years indoors. These prints are eco-friendly and can be completed in real quick time.

Invite Locals To Events At Your Office 

Boring advertisements that showcase your real estate agent services aren’t always effective. People tend to receive these Realtor postcards or flyer pieces in the mail and toss them without so much as a second glance. 

Instead of creating boring flyers, turn your next direct mail advertising campaign into an invitation. 

Host a meet and greet at your office. Invite people in your target area to get to know you and give them a reason to come to your office. 

This could be free food, a house concert with a local musician, or an informative presentation designed to help prospective homebuyers overcome the challenges they face. 

You can even partner with other businesses in the area to put together a bigger event that will help each of you increase your network and build new realty client relationships. 

Send Holiday Cards To Previous Clients 

Staying in touch with your previous clients is a wonderful way to earn referrals and recommendations. However, if you are like most real estate agents, reaching out without a reason can feel a bit awkward. Worse, it can leave your previous clients feeling confused. 

Save yourself the stress (and potential embarrassment) by sending them a branded holiday card as part of your direct mail marketing strategy. Keep things simple and lighthearted, but make sure your logo and contact info is clear on your design. 

You never know when they will learn that a friend or coworker is ready to look for a house. Your clients can use that holiday card much like a business card to pass your information to people who need it. 

Include A Branded Gift 

Whenever you send out direct mail marketing materials, you need to make sure your brand is easy to identify. The last thing you want people to do is glance at your mailer, shrug, and toss it away. 

Try to include a branded gift with everything you send out. This doesn’t have to be anything big. A magnet, pen, keychain, or letter opener is all you need to include. That way, they will still have something to remember your information by even if they throw out the mailer it came with. 

No matter what you choose, make sure the mailer design has easy-to-read contact information and shows your logo clearly. This will help them keep your name in mind anytime someone mentions looking for a real estate agent.
